Fleming Leads Men's @WidenerSwimming at Ramapo

MAHWAH, N.J. – The Widener University men's swimming team closed its 2019-20 regular season with a handful of strong performances as the Pride fell 174-88 to Ramapo on Saturday.
 
Chris Fleming picked up wins for the Pride in the 100 and 200 fly, finishing in times of 56.12 and 2:03.11 respectively.
 
Mark Lukens won the 50 free, touching the wall in 22.62.
 
Daniel Parker had a couple of second place finishes. He completed the 200 fly in 2:05.82 and the 500 free in 5:07.86.
 
Parker and Lukens were joined by Nick Masciandaro and John Porter Luksic in the 200 medley relay for a second place time of 1:41.37.
 
Next up for Widener is the MAC Championships held at the Graham Aquatic Center in York, Pa., February 13-16.
